Transaction 1743848f5eb56fa35f986d4e50df8c38995cf12936f0fb8ee52ee846a43ee31b

1 Input
2 Outputs
  • 1743848f5eb56fa35f986d4e50df8c38995cf12936f0fb8ee52ee846a43ee31b:0
  • value  385263
    address  34QZzJ6bjzCCV3fbm71vujbQFRxtjJxDYn
  • 1743848f5eb56fa35f986d4e50df8c38995cf12936f0fb8ee52ee846a43ee31b:1
  • value  38412227
    address  3F4KpmUr9Nm3nGBEyS2ak6XaqKFZsi4wmy